Transaction 4334bd832f7629bfba6c923bfb30339d65c3a55e2d27017250b7ef8911007737
1 Input
2 Outputs
- 4334bd832f7629bfba6c923bfb30339d65c3a55e2d27017250b7ef8911007737:0
- 4334bd832f7629bfba6c923bfb30339d65c3a55e2d27017250b7ef8911007737:1
value 7010
address 1JxbvzTAfYAkQozzybN1iYLKKrUF3uDm7d
value 30227500
address 1Haa8PPhH1CvsY356pMF8nNupbV3aRRFrA